Reflections on yesterday's protests in #London. 1/n

Background info:

I like photographing protests. It's a hobby and I have been doing it for over 10 years. Mainly in Bristol and London. My politics are left, but I try to suppress my bias when behind the lens - not always an easy thing to do.

I went to London specifically to photograph the protests. I arrived at about 10am and left at about 6. I spent most of my time amongst ‘Tommy' supporters - unusual for me as generally I walk amongst the ‘left’. Westminster Bridge, Whitehall, Trafalgar Square, The Strand, and Northumberland Avenue was my patch for the day - apart from when the rain came and I spent a nice half hour browsing in Waterstones.

The following reflections are my random thoughts about the day based on what I saw, my own personal bias, and what I have seen at recent protests.
